MHN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

30 of the 3,447 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BlackRock MuniHoldings New Yrok Quality Fund (MHN)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$15.8M — up 7.1% from $14.7M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 8 funds opened new MHN posit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 7 added to existing stakes and 10 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$1.03M. The largest seller was Guggenheim Capital, cutting an estimated $521K.
